Hi there. I'm Teej. I'm in the process of restoring the car that I got my driver's license in Ontario way back in 1981, it's a 77 Monte. It belonged to my Mom's BF and a year later, he sold it to a guy that was moving to BC. I moved to BC in 92 but I never thought I would see it again. I was wrong.
About 5 years ago, a friend of my daughter's was tree planting in Prince George and needed a way home to the kootenays so he bought this old Monte. When he showed up at our house, I thought I had seen a ghost. I paid for a record check and sure enough, it was the same car. I told him that if he ever wanted to get rid of it, I would buy it.
About 2 years ago, he gave me a call and I brought my baby home. So far, the engine and tranny have been rebuilt and now I'm starting on suspension and body work.
